Output db58ca72c88ef77d3fbce8d15e1df531b8cd2a8c3335fe066ad10cffcaad47eb:0

value
66057391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9fc62a9fa7f9a10f43fa89f837b6c33411480a2 OP_EQUAL
address
3QUpXMYPnUFCBx9no8c8kx43z1BVJXvVAN
transaction
db58ca72c88ef77d3fbce8d15e1df531b8cd2a8c3335fe066ad10cffcaad47eb
spent
true